Hotel Chocolat and Knoops Face Off with Godiva - The Robin Report

Summary by The Robin Report
Hotel Chocolat’s Thirlwell described the acquisition of the 250-acre Rabot Estate in Saint Lucia and transforming it into a boutique hotel as “destiny.” After a customer sent Thirwell a 1920s book about chocolate making while he was visiting his father in the Caribbean, he was inspired to fulfill his dream to create a place where luxury, wellbeing and style could come together with, naturally, cocoa and chocolate.
